Tail recursion python
Web12 Feb 2024 · Pros and cons of using recursion in Python by Martin McBride Geek Culture Feb, 2024 Medium Write Sign up Sign In 500 Apologies, but something went wrong on … WebWhat Is Recursion? Why Use Recursion? Recursion in Python Get Started: Count Down to Zero Calculate Factorial Define a Python Factorial Function Speed Comparison of …
Tail recursion python
Did you know?
W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Web3 Dec 2013 · Optimizing tail-recursion in Python is in fact quite easy. While it is said to be impossible or very tricky, I think it can be achieved with elegant, short and general …
Web13 Dec 2024 · Write a recursive function to reverse a list Author: Miguel Trexler Date: 2024-12-13 Solution 1: in the syntax [H T], H is an element and T is a list (at least for proplist), in … Web25 Jan 2024 · Tail recursion is defined as a recursive function in which the recursive call is the last statement that is executed by the function. So basically nothing is left to execute …
Web28 Jan 2024 · There are mainly 5 types of recursion:-Tail ; Head; Tree; Indirect; Nested; What is a Tail Recursion? In a recursive function when the function call is made at the very end … Web这是一个关于 Python 递归深度限制的问题。当递归深度超过限制时,会出现递归错误。根据你提供的信息,递归深度限制分别为1000、2000和5000时,出现递归错误的嵌套导入次数分别为115、240和660。
WebThere are six types of recursion: Non-Tail Recursion (head recursion) tail recursion Direct Recursion Indirect Recursion Linear recursion Tree Recursion In this article at …
light wood bathroom accessoriesWeb30 Sep 2024 · As we can see, this function is not tail-recursive, because we don't return direct result of recursive call of fib but result of sum of two recursive calls. So even if … light wood bathroom mirrorWeb8 Tail Call Optimization. In the previous chapter, we covered using memoization to optimize recursive functions. This chapter explores a technique called tail call optimization, which … light wood bathroom vanityWeb24 Mar 2024 · Tail recursion is just a particular instance of recursion, where the return value of a function is calculated as a call to itself, and nothing else. # normal recursive of factorial def... light wood bathroom vanity 42 inchWeb17 Mar 2024 · While some programming language automatically recognise and optimise tail recursive function, Python is one that prefers to have proper tracebacks. The creator of … light wood bathroom vanity 48 inchWebScala河内塔的尾部递归,scala,tail-recursion,towers-of-hanoi,Scala,Tail Recursion,Towers Of Hanoi,我是Scala编程新手。 我的目标是为河内塔问题实现一个尾部递归程序。 我相信可以通过如下递归实现: // Implementing a recursive function for Towers of Hanoi,where the no of disks is taken as 'n', 'from ... light wood bathroom vanity canadaWeb2 Aug 2024 · What is tail recursion? A recursive function becomes a tail recursive function when the last thing executed by the function is the recursive call. The tail recursive … light wood beach house coffee table